10. Her Upbringing Wasn't The Easiest
Long before she was ever considered the '9th Wonder of the World', Joan Marie Laurer was the youngest child of Joe and Janet Laurer. She had two older sisters, and her formative years were spent in Rochester (New York). Things took a turn for the difficult fairly early on however, as her parents divorced when she was four years old.
Joan would have three different stepfathers and one stepmother, and each turn came with its own problems. By her own admission her first stepfather attempted suicide, and her biological father struggled with alcoholism. The family moved on a number of occasions.
This lack of stability was exacerbated throughout school. Too often we forget that life is hard, and growing up is one of the hardest parts of life. Laurer had spoken in the past of the abuse she suffered and her struggles with purging, which led to her mother trying to get her to attend a drug rehab facility. Joan went to live with her father as a result.
Joan was able to flourish despite these issues, and she eventually graduated from the University of Tampa in 1992 with a degree in Spanish Literature.
